David Lampkins, 66, of Murray, Kentucky, passed away at his home and went to be with his Lord and Savior, Jesus Christ, on August 30, 2015, at 4:10 P.M.  

David was born in Paducah, KY, on November 6, 1948, to Dewey Lampkins, Jr. and Imogene Dulaney Lampkins. He graduated from Murray High School in 1968. David graduated from Lindsey Wilson University with a degree in Business Administration.  He  graduated from Campbellsville University in 1972 with a degree in Marketing Education.  At Murray State University, he received his Masters Degree in Education and his 30+ in Administration Supervision and Coordination of Vocational Education.  In 2014, he retired as an English as a Second Language Teacher at MSU after nine years.   David also retired from teaching in Marshall County in 2004 where he taught business and Distributive Education classes at Marshall County Technical School for 34.5 years. He was awarded for 33 years of exceptional service and dedication to the Kentucky Association of DECA.   He served as a Region I DECA Chairman.  His marketing classroom served as a pilot site for the development of the Kentucky Retail Service Skill Standards.  The Kentucky Consumer Finance Association awarded him Kentucky Teacher of the Year in 1979. He  was awarded Kentucky Marketing Education Teacher of the Year by the Kentucky Marketing Education Association 1997-98, 2002-03, and 2003-04.  

David was a member of Hardin Baptist Church where he served as Sunday School Superintendent and Deacon.  He also served as Blood River Baptist Association Treasurer from 1987 - 1994.
David is survived by his wife of 44 years, Teri Keys Lampkins; two sons, Andrew Christopher Lampkins, wife Christina Cass Lampkins, and granddaughter Madison of Fort Myers, Florida; and Scott Wesley Lampkins, wife Jerilyn Lampkins, and grandson Wesley of Benton, Kentucky; mother, Imogene Lampkins of Murray, KY; brothers, Danny Lampkins of Benton, KY; and Dean and Debbie Blakley Lampkins of Mayfield, KY.  

He was preceded in death by his father, Dewey Lampkins, Jr., and brother Donald Gene Lampkins.
